A064513 Maximal number of nodes in graph of degree <= n and diameter 2 (another version). +0
2
2, 4, 10, 15, 24 (list; graph; listen)

EXAMPLE

a(3) = 10 is achieved by the Petersen graph.

Same as A058201 except for final term. I do not know which version is correct! - N. J. A. Sloane (njas(AT)research.att.com).

It is known that a(6) >= 32, a(7)=50, a(8) >= 57, etc.
